Netflix began in 1997 as a DVD rental service and has since expanded to become the world's largest online video streaming service. The paper discusses Netflix's history and strategic issues related to acquiring content from Hollywood studios. It also analyzes Netflix's general environment using Porter's Five Forces model. Key points include Netflix's challenges in obtaining content as studios try to protect DVD revenue and developing exclusive shows. The analysis examines Netflix's demographic, economic, sociocultural, legal/political, and technological factors.
